All early classes had 14 skills and one basic attack. ChronoZ was one of the earlier classes to experiment with skill combos, and unlocking alternate attacks based on the combo of skills used prior, rather than having 14 individual skills that don't necessarily work with one another. As such, even without those last three skills, ChronoZ is still a very powerful class, and even as a special offer class with three more skills in addition to the combo skills it likely would have been overpowered, similar to Archivist with its incomplete skill set. Obviously classes released in recent times are a lot more interactive and complex than the 14-skill model, with modification widgets and skills that can be used multiple times to increase their power/effect, but it was all relatively new territory at the time with ChronoZ. For what it's worth, in some specific instances, a turnskip skill might actually be the best option.
